Understanding the Core Mechanics of Prize-Based Platforms
Prize-based platforms, including those similar to jackpotraider, generally operate on a tiered system. Players typically purchase credits or tokens which are then used to participate in various games or draws. The structure often involves a combination of luck and strategic choice allowing participants to select which opportunities to engage with. These opportunities range from simple raffles and lotteries to more complex games requiring skill or prediction. The value of the prizes varies considerably, from small cash awards to significant jackpot amounts, which contributes to the allure of these platforms.
A critical element to grasp is the concept of probability and return to player (RTP). RTP represents the percentage of all wagered money that is theoretically returned to players over time. A higher RTP suggests a more favorable outcome for participants, but it’s important to remember that RTP is a long-term average, and individual results will vary. Examining the specific terms and conditions of a platform and the details of each game is paramount to understanding the odds and potential payouts. Truly understanding the mechanics helps to dispel misconceptions and promote more informed decision-making.
The Role of Random Number Generators (RNGs)
The fairness and integrity of these platforms depend heavily on the implementation of robust Random Number Generators (RNGs). RNGs are algorithms designed to produce statistically random results, ensuring that each game or draw is unbiased and unpredictable. Reputable platforms undergo independent auditing by third-party organizations to verify the fairness and reliability of their RNGs. These audits assess the randomness of the results, and the overall trustworthiness of the system. Transparency regarding the RNG process is a sign of a reputable operation. Verification of independent auditing is a crucial step in assessing the legitimacy of a platform before participating.
Without a properly functioning and verified RNG, the possibility of manipulation or bias exists, undermining the integrity of the entire system. Ensuring the RNG’s legitimacy means that outcomes are genuinely based on chance, and participants have a fair opportunity to win. It's essential to seek platforms that prominently display their audit certifications and provide transparent information about their RNG protocols.

Managing Your Bankroll Effectively
Effective bankroll management is a cornerstone of responsible participation. Dividing your available funds into smaller, manageable units – akin to setting daily or weekly allowances – helps to prevent substantial losses. Avoid putting all your eggs in one basket; diversifying your participation across various games or draws can mitigate risk. Consider using a staking plan, such as a fixed percentage of your bankroll per wager, to maintain control over your spending. Regularly reviewing your spending habits and adjusting your strategy as needed is also important.
One useful technique is to set win targets and stop when you reach them. Conversely, a loss limit should also be set, and adhered to, to prevent further losses. Remember, the goal is to enjoy the entertainment, not to recoup losses or chase unrealistic profits. A disciplined approach to bankroll management safeguards your finances and promotes responsible gaming behavior.
